#d03c34 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d03c34 is composed of 81.6% red, 23.5%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.2% magenta, 75%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 3.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 51%. #d03c34 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7868 with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#d03c34 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d03c34 has RGB values of R:208, G:60,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.75,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13646900.

Shades and Tints of #d03c34
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f3 is the lightest one.
